Popularity
6.2
Stable
Activity
0.0
Stable
760
40
741

Code Quality Rank: L2
Monthly Downloads: 0
Programming language: JavaScript
License: MIT License
Tags: Communication systems     Custom     Mumble    
Latest version: v1.0.0

Node-Chat alternatives and similar software solutions

Based on the "Mumble" category.
Alternatively, view Node-Chat alternatives based on common mentions on social networks and blogs.

Do you think we are missing an alternative of Node-Chat or a related project?

Add another 'Mumble' Software solution

README

Node.JS Chat

GitHub Stars GitHub Issues Current Version Live Demo Gitter

This is a node.js chat application powered by SockJS and Express that provides the main functions you'd expect from a chat, such as emojis, private messages, an admin system, etc.

Chat Preview


Buy me a coffee

Whether you use this project, have learned something from it, or just like it, please consider supporting it by buying me a coffee, so I can dedicate more time on open-source projects like this :)


Features

  • Material Design
  • Emoji support
  • User @mentioning
  • Private messaging
  • Message deleting (for admins)
  • Ability to kick/ban users (for admins)
  • See other user's IPs (for admins)
  • Other awesome features yet to be implemented

User Features

Admin Features

There are 3 admin levels:
  • Helper: Can delete chat messages
  • Moderator: The above plus the ability to kick and ban users
  • Administrator: All the above plus send global alerts and promote/demote users

Setup

Clone this repo to your desktop and run npm install to install all the dependencies.

You might want to look into config.json to make change the port you want to use and set up a SSL certificate.


Usage

After you clone this repo to your desktop, go to its root directory and run npm install to install its dependencies.

Once the dependencies are installed, you can run npm start to start the application. You will then be able to access it at localhost:3000

To give yourself administrator permissions on the chat, you will have to type /role [your-name] in the app console.


License

You can check out the full license here

This project is licensed under the terms of the MIT license.


*Note that all licence references and agreements mentioned in the Node-Chat README section above are relevant to that project's source code only.